This is a ranking of highest domestic net collection of Hindi films, which includes films in the Hindi language, based on the conservative global box office estimates as reported by industry sources. However, there is no official tracking of figures, and sources publishing data are frequently pressured to increase their estimates.

A dubbed Hindi version, Slumdog Crorepati (स्लमडॉग करोड़पति), was also released in India in addition to the original version of the film. [64] The name was changed as Indians are more familiar with Indian numbering , including the crore , than the Western numbering of one million. [ 65 ]
The Hungry is a 2017 Indian drama film directed by Bornila Chatterjee. [2] It was filmed by London-based cinematographer Nick Cooke. [ 3 ] It was screened in the Special Presentations section at the 2017 Toronto International Film Festival [ 4 ] and is a modern adaptation of Titus Andronicus by William Shakespeare .
